so the other night i sat down and read the book "leadership and self deception: getting out of the box" ok book. but the stuff in it is ridiculous. there is this mental state they call "the box" and they explain how you get in and how to get out and all that fun stuff

 

and they also explain what happens in the box and how you distort the world and cause problems and stuff. i would definitely recommend reading it if you want to know why some people have so much drama in their lives and others just seem to avoid all of it.

 

but anyways. ever since i read the book i am notice all of these things the book predicted i would do. to summarize the book says basically that once in the box you maximize others' faults and minimize your own to justify the way you are acting so you feel better about yourself and turn into the victim of the world.

 

now whenever i'm driving if i think to let someone go before me and i decide not to all of a sudden i am coming up with "i'm late for work, i'm tired, blah blah blah" and "they should have gone slower so i got there first, they arent as important as me, blah blah blah" and then i'm like WTH how can some book tell me how i think when i dont even know that i'm thinking that way.

 

but on the bright side since i started doing what it says things have been happier for me and i'm less mad at people when they do things that used to really tick me off yay learning!!
